NEWPORT BEACH, Calif. (AP) _ Clean Energy Fuels Corp. (CLNE) on Thursday reported a fourth-quarter loss of $50 million, after reporting a profit in the same period a year earlier.

The Newport Beach, California-based company said it had a loss of 54 cents per share. Earnings, adjusted for non-recurring costs and stock option expense, were 8 cents per share.

The results surpassed Wall Street expectations. The average estimate of three analysts surveyed by Zacks Investment Research was for a loss of 4 cents per share.

The provider of natural gas as an alternative fuel for vehicle fleets posted revenue of $119.3 million in the period.

For the year, the company reported that its loss widened to $134.2 million, or $1.47 per share. Revenue was reported as $384.3 million.
